    Apple’s new products meet with mixed market reaction

    Apple’s highly anticipated launch event concluded with a mixed market response. Despite unveiling a range of innovative products, including the iPhone 16, Apple Watch Series 10, and AirPods 4, the company’s shares fell by approximately 1.6% on Monday afternoon.

    The iPhone 16, the centerpiece of the event, showcased significant advancements in artificial intelligence and performance. The Pro models feature the A18 Pro chip, enabling enhanced photo organization, video recording, and overall performance. Apple also introduced Apple Intelligence, a generative AI software set to launch in October and offer new AI-driven features for the iPhone.

    Beyond the iPhone, Apple unveiled the redesigned Apple Watch Series 10, its thinnest and fastest watch yet. The watch incorporates a new chip for improved machine learning capabilities and offers enhanced health-focused features like sleep and physical activity tracking. The AirPods 4, featuring improved sound quality, noise cancellation, and transparency modes, were also showcased.

    However, the market’s attention was also drawn to Huawei’s recent announcement of record pre-orders for its new foldable phone. This highlights the growing competition between the two tech giants, particularly in the Chinese market. Huawei’s resurgence poses a significant challenge to Apple’s dominance.

    While Apple continues to innovate and deliver cutting-edge products, the decline in its stock price indicates the pressure it faces in a highly competitive global market. Huawei’s success in China underscores the need for Apple to strengthen its strategy and maintain its position in key Asian markets, where competition is intensifying.
